Temperature

Monitoring the temperature of your Koi pond is essential.  We recommend that a thermometer be floated in the filter/converter system or tied to an easy access point at the edge of the pond. 

CAUTION: Small floating glass thermometers can be swallowed by Koi.

Ideal Temperature  Range
65°F-75°F 20°C-25°C
Acceptable Temperature  Range

35°F-85°F

2°C-30°C

On most occasions temperature will be lowest in the morning just before sunrise and the highest at sunset.   Temperature is influenced by the amount of sun, the intensity of the sun the pond receives and other factors such as the wind speed during the day or night. Evaporation cools the water.   Generally speaking Koi should not be subject to more than a 3 - 5ºC sudden change in water temperature.   Always adjust the temperature gradually when moving Koi around.  An increase in temperature is tolerated better than a decrease in temperature.  Most ponds have a 1 - 3ºC variation in temperature in 24 hour cycle.   You will notice that Koi are more affected by a sudden lowering of water temperature than a sudden raising of water temperature.

Feeding fish versus Temperature:

  • Less than 50°F Do Not Feed
  • 50°F-60°F 2-4 times weekly
  • 60°F-85°F 2-4 times daily
  • Above 85°F Do Not Feed

In all cases, try to feed only what the fish will normally consume in about 10 minutes. Remove any uneaten food within an hour.
